Understanding the mechanics behind gravity energy storage systems is essential to grasp their functionality. These systems typically consist of a weight or mass, a lifting mechanism, and a control system designed to manage the lifting and lowering processes.

A gravity battery is a type of energy storage device that stores gravitational energy —the potential energy E given to an object with a mass m when it is raised against the force of gravity of Earth (g, 9.8 m/s²) into a height difference h. In a common application, when renewable energy sources.
